Nomination for Assistant Secretaries of Defense
March 30, 1993

    The President announced his intention today to nominate Edward 
Warner to be Assistant Secretary of Defense for Strategy and Resources 
and Charles Freeman to be Assistant Secretary of Defense for Regional 
Security.
    ``Ted Warner and Charles Freeman are two of the most outstanding 
people working on defense issues today,'' said the President. ``I am 
extremely pleased that they are joining Secretary Aspin at the 
Pentagon.''
